4chan: 4chan is an imageboard website where users can post images and comments anonymously. Its most popular board is /pol/, which focuses on politics and current events.

Webflow: Webflow is a no-code web design tool that allows users to build responsive websites visually without coding. It has drag-and-drop functionality, templates, interactions, animations and hosting capabilities.

Webflow
Webflow
Pros
  • No coding required
  • Intuitive visual interface
  • Great for prototyping and launching sites quickly
  • Has free and paid plans
  • Good support and community
Cons
  • Steep learning curve
  • Limitations compared to custom code
  • Hosting can be expensive
  • Limited CMS functionality
